Crashing Cairo is a four-piece indie/alternative band from Detroit, Michigan. In 2007, they played several venues around Detroit and finished recording the tracks for their debut full-length album, Monday Changed Everything.

The members of Crashing Cairo will be promoting Monday Changed Everything throughout 2008 with a steady diet of gigs at local venues and a tour of the East Coast. Their debut release is filled with alternative rock gems. "See" and "Hair," two live-show rockers, are featured on the new CD, along with 8 other songs spanning a vast musical spectrum.

Each member of the group draws on a variety of musical experiences. Singer/guitarist/keyboardist Robert Wax plays whatever is needed while keeping the song flowing on vocals. Bob Gilbert brings a tribal sound on drums while exuding the energy the rest of the group feeds from live. Lead guitarist Joel Cooper's soaring leads and technical brilliance draw comparisons to U2 and Radiohead. Nick Potter keeps the low end moving and grooving on bass.
